Located in New South Wales within the Inverell local government area, Wandera is a quiet locality (postcode 2360). It is home to about 15 residents, with an older-leaning population and a median age of 52. Households earn a median income of $47K per year, with an average household size of 1.5 people. The top ancestries reported are Australian, English, Filipino.
Wandera has a median house price of $165,000, which has dropped significantly by 44.1% year-on-year. The current median weekly rent is $460. This gives a gross rental yield of approximately 14.5%. The median monthly mortgage repayment is $1,276.
The crime rate in the Inverell LGA is moderate at 4,989 incidents per 100,000 population.
